Crystal Liu

Crystal Liu

Consultant

Crystal joined SC Group in April 2023 as a Consultant and is based in London. She brings to the team a strong passion for life sciences as well as prior experiences in healthcare consulting and financial services.


Prior to joining SC Group, Crystal focused on consulting to big pharma in relation to pharma digital landscaping initiatives, market and corporate transaction analysis and strategic partnerships across pharma value chain. She has also advised big pharma on assessing ‘loss of exclusivity’ threats for oncology assets across the EU and UK markets. Before that, Crystal was an audit associate in KPMG and risk advisory intern at Deloitte.


Crystal holds an MSc in Drug Discovery and Pharma Management from University College London and a BSc in Chemistry from King’s College London. 

Share by: